In a bid to assess the progress of the ongoing construction of the Khamrang to Sihhmui rail route, Lok Sabha MP C Lalrosanga today visited the construction site of the rail project in Mizoram.

Lok Sabha MP C Lalrosanga said that soon after the completion of the rail line from Khamrang to Sihhmui, there will be work on the extension of the railway line to South Mizoram.

While the initial plan was to complete the construction work by March 2024, the Northern Frontier Railway has now decided to complete the project by December 2023.

Lalrosanga further added that the 223-km long Sairang to Hmawng-buchhuah railway line is linked with the Kolodyne Multi Modal Transit Transport Project and, on completion, would give a much-needed boost to the infrastructure development of the State.

It is worth mentioning here that, under the initiative of Prime Minister Narendra Modi, construction work is going on for railway projects worth Rs 39,000 crore in the Northeast.
